Understanding Conversion Optimization

Conversion rate optimization (CRO) is the systematic process of increasing the percentage of visitors who complete a desired action. For e-commerce, that typically means making a purchase.

Why it matters:

  • A 1% increase in conversion rate can double your profits
  • It's cheaper to convert existing traffic than acquire new visitors
  • Better conversion rates mean better ROI on all marketing efforts

The Essential Elements

1. Fast Loading Speed

Speed directly impacts conversions. For every second delay:

  • Conversions drop by 7%
  • Bounce rate increases by 32%
  • Customer satisfaction decreases significantly

Optimization strategies:

  • Compress images without quality loss
  • Use lazy loading for images
  • Implement browser caching
  • Use a CDN for faster delivery
  • Minimize code and scripts
  • Choose quality hosting

Target: Under 3 seconds load time

2. Mobile Optimization

Over 70% of e-commerce traffic comes from mobile devices.

Must-haves:

  • Responsive design that adapts to any screen
  • Touch-friendly buttons and navigation
  • Simplified checkout process
  • Mobile-optimized payment options
  • Readable text without zooming
  • Quick-access search functionality

8. Streamlined Checkout

67% of carts are abandoned—mostly due to checkout issues.

Checkout optimization:

  • Guest checkout option
  • Progress indicator
  • Minimal form fields
  • Auto-fill and address lookup
  • Multiple payment options
  • Save for later option
  • Clear error messages
  • Mobile-optimized design
  • No surprise costs
  • Security reassurance

Ideal checkout: 3 steps or fewer

Measuring Success

Track these metrics to understand your performance:

Primary Metrics:

  • **Conversion Rate**: Percentage of visitors who purchase
  • **Average Order Value**: Average purchase amount
  • **Cart Abandonment Rate**: Percentage who add to cart but don't buy
  • **Revenue per Visitor**: Total revenue divided by total visitors

Secondary Metrics:

  • Time on site
  • Pages per session
  • Product page views
  • Add-to-cart rate
  • Checkout start rate
  • Checkout completion rate

The Testing Mindset

Optimization is ongoing. Implement A/B testing for:

  • Headlines and copy
  • CTA button colors and text
  • Product page layouts
  • Checkout flow variations
  • Email campaign elements
  • Pricing strategies
  • Promotional offers

Testing best practices:

  • Test one element at a time
  • Run tests long enough for statistical significance
  • Document all tests and results
  • Implement winning variations
  • Continue testing—there's always room for improvement
